ūsurpātōrĭus , a, um, adj. usurpator,
I.usurping, usurpatory: “temeritas,Cod. Just. 10, 47, 8.—Adv.: ūsurpātōrĭē , presumptuously, pretentiously, Ambros. Hexaëm. 3, 15, n. 64; id. in Psa. 118, Serm. 5, § 23 al.
